고혈압은 수축기 혈압이 130mmHg 이상이거나 이완기 혈압이 80mmHg를 초과하는 것으로 정의되는 동맥 혈압의 지속적인 상승을 특징으로 하는 만성 질환입니다.
고혈압은 1차 또는 2차 원인으로 인해 발생할 수 있습니다.
원발성 고혈압은 뚜렷한 병인은 없지만 나트륨 섭취 증가, 좌식 생활 방식, 담배 사용, 과도한 알코올 섭취와 같은 요인의 영향을 받습니다.
반대로, 이차성 고혈압은 좌심실 비대 및 관상 동맥 질환과 같은 식별 가능한 원인으로 인해 발생합니다.
성인의 고혈압은 다음과 같이 분류됩니다.
혈압 상승은 수축기 혈압이 120에서 129mmHg 사이이고 이완기 혈압이 80mmHg 미만인 것으로 표시됩니다.
1단계 고혈압은 수축기 혈압이 130-139mmHg 사이 또는 이완기 혈압이 80-89mmHg 사이인 것으로 표시됩니다.
마지막으로, 2단계 고혈압은 수축기 혈압이 140mmHg 이상이거나 이완기 혈압이 90mmHg를 초과할 때 표시됩니다.

Q1: What blood pressure readings define hypertension?
Hypertension is characterized by systolic pressure of 130 mmHg or higher or diastolic pressure exceeding 80 mmHg. These thresholds distinguish hypertension from normal blood pressure and guide clinical diagnosis. Blood pressure classification helps healthcare providers determine appropriate intervention strategies for managing this chronic arterial condition.
Q2: How does primary hypertension differ from secondary hypertension?
Primary hypertension has no identifiable cause but involves genetic and environmental factors like sodium intake, sedentary lifestyle, and tobacco use. Secondary hypertension, accounting for 5-10% of cases, results from identifiable underlying conditions such as left ventricular hypertrophy or coronary artery disease. Secondary hypertension requires thorough investigation, especially in sudden onset or drug-resistant cases.
Q3: What lifestyle factors contribute to primary hypertension development?
Primary hypertension is influenced by high sodium intake, obesity, sedentary lifestyle, aging, genetic predisposition, ethnicity, tobacco use, excessive alcohol consumption, and diabetes. Changes in endothelial function and increased sympathetic nervous system activity also play roles. These modifiable and non-modifiable factors create a complex interplay affecting blood vessel regulation and pressure elevation.
Q4: What are the blood pressure ranges for stage 1 hypertension?
Stage 1 hypertension is marked by systolic pressure between 130 and 139 mmHg or diastolic pressure between 80 and 89 mmHg. This classification requires lifestyle modification and, in some cases, medication to manage blood pressure levels effectively. Stage 1 represents an intermediate severity requiring intervention to prevent progression to stage 2.
Q5: When does elevated blood pressure require intervention?
Elevated blood pressure, indicated by systolic pressure between 120 and 129 mmHg with diastolic pressure below 80 mmHg, serves as a critical alert stage signaling the need for lifestyle modifications. This classification helps prevent hypertension progression before it reaches stage 1 or stage 2 severity. Early intervention at this stage can reduce future cardiovascular complications.
Q6: What target organ damage indicates secondary hypertension?
Excessive target organ damage signals secondary hypertension and may include cerebral vascular disease, retinopathy, chronic kidney disease, left ventricular hypertrophy, coronary artery disease, or peripheral arterial disease. These conditions warrant investigation to identify underlying causes. Understanding these manifestations helps clinicians recognize when hypertension stems from identifiable medical conditions requiring specific treatment approaches.
Q7: What blood pressure readings constitute a hypertensive crisis?
A hypertensive crisis occurs when systolic pressure exceeds 180 mmHg and/or diastolic pressure exceeds 120 mmHg, requiring immediate medical attention. This severe elevation poses acute risk for organ damage and cardiovascular complications. Hypertensive crisis represents the most severe classification and demands urgent intervention to prevent life-threatening consequences.
